President Akufo-Addo, Mahama join in State Burial for ET Mensah

A State funeral has been held at the Forecourt of the State House for the former Member of Parliament for the Ningo-Prampram Constituency and Council of State member, Enoch Teye Mensah, popularly known as ET Mensah. President Akufo-Addo swears in 3 new Supreme Court Justices; calls for high judicial excellence

By: Bright Ntramah President Akufo-Addo has sworn three new justices of the Supreme Court into office and charged them to strengthen the development of Ghana’s constitution, and ensure that their judgments contribute to the development of the nation. Government to implement Policies to enhance favourable business environment

By: Bright Ntramah Government is to collaborate with the Ghana Employers Association to develop and implement Policies that will help reduce the cost of doing business.
